Наши проекты:
Журнал · Discuz!ML · Wiki · DRKB · Помощь проекту |
||
ПРАВИЛА | FAQ | Помощь | Поиск | Участники | Календарь | Избранное | RSS |
[18.117.107.90] |
|
Сообщ.
#1
,
|
|
|
Есть окно класса CView. На нем создано окно проигрывателя MCI и запускается проигрывание видео файла.
MyMCI = MCIWndCreate(this->m_hWnd, AfxGetApp()->m_hInstance, WS_CHILD | WS_BORDER | WS_VISIBLE | WS_SIZEBOX, _T("Ps.avi")); ::MoveWindow(MyMCI, 10, 10, r.Width()-20, r.Height()-20, FALSE); MCIWndPlay(MyMCI); При изменении размера CView, изменяется размер MCI. if (MyMCI != NULL) { CRect r; ::GetClientRect(this->m_hWnd, &r); ::MoveWindow(MyMCI, 100, 100, r.Width() - 200, r.Height() - 200, TRUE); }; Все работает, но при изменении размера окна воспроизведение файла начинается сначала. В чем дело? |